OpenAI is offering its ChatGPT Go plan free for one year to all users in India, beginning November 4 for a limited promotional period. This move focuses on solidifying the company’s standing in one of its largest markets. Existing Go subscribers will also receive the complimentary 12-month access. India presents an immense opportunity with its vast internet and smartphone user base. However, making money from ChatGPT’s paid services has proven difficult, despite millions of downloads. ChatGPT Go offers ten times the usage of the free version for generating responses, creating images, and improving memory for personalized interactions. This robust offering arrives as rivals like Perplexity and Google also vie for India’s large user base. OpenAI plans further India-specific announcements at its upcoming DevDay Exchange in Bengaluru.
